Bruce Ma
I am happy that there is finally a hotpot place in Northern Massachusetts. This place has a cool interior. Got a good metro vibe to it. The menu is very simple. You order the items you want, like meats, veggies, tofu, etc. There is no combo choices. So expect to spend quite a bit for a complete meal (meat + starch + veggie). You can pick two soups to start, then order what food items to cook (by yourself). Right now they are doing a soft opening. The waitress told me to expect a long wait for the food. I ended up waited for about 45 minutes. Because I read the reviews ahead of time, I was watching YouTube while waiting. It wasn’t too annoying. The quality of meat was good. But I wish there were larger portions. Obviously you can always order more. Overall, I think the experience is positive. But because it is not a all you can eat place, you will need to spend a bit more money if you want to fill your stomach. The waitress was very friendly.

James Maloney
This by far is the best Hot Pot that I have had period. The photos you see do not disappoint. It’s a classy and polished atmosphere that won’t break the bank. I highly recommend this place for a date. The food doesn’t slack on presentation and tastes even better. Beef is served with dry ice: how about that for dramatic affect? My expectations where blown. If you have never had hot pot, this is a good place to start. The options seem overwhelming, but the choice of seafood, beef or vegetable pots can really narrow that down without taking away for the experience. Something that I have not seen at other hot pot restaurants are shared pots that only require one hot plate. There was less to worry about and the divided pot could hold two broths. This sounds like a small detail, but it can made a big difference in terms of space and efficiency, especially if you are sharing a meal with someone close. My only complaint was that the tables were a little low. Still, the flavor of the beef broth will have you fixated on picking and choosing what you are going to put in your pot next. With all of the positive factors, this was truly hard to notice.
